Kingsport Mets 4 (24-41), Danville Braves 0 Box Score
- Ricardo Cespedes CF 4 for 4, 3B, CS, .324
- Jeremy Wolf 1B 2 for 4, RBI, K .296
- Walter Rasquin 2B 1 for 3, K .293
Cespedes has been on fire in August, hitting seven extra base hits (3 2B, 3 3B, 1 HR) after hitting two entering into the month. He had been not doing well against left handers, hitting .268/.297/.296 leading into the night, but then hit a triple and a single off Collective Bargaining Pick, Joey Wentz.
